· Product Overview
This modular component kit features precision-machined 6061-T6 aluminum parts—including perforated plates, circular rings, slotted bars, mounting brackets, and cylindrical supports—engineered for building custom, lightweight, and durable frameworks. The kit’s standardized hole patterns and modular design enable quick, tool-free assembly (or reconfiguration) of frames, brackets, and workstations, while 6061-T6 aluminum balances high tensile strength (≥290 MPa) and low weight. Ideal for both industrial equipment builds and DIY projects, these components deliver consistent fit and long-term structural stability.
· Core Specifications
- Material: 6061-T6 Aluminum AlloyLightweight (1/3 the density of steel), high tensile strength, and excellent machinability; finished with natural anodization (scratch-resistant + corrosion-resistant).
- Manufacturing Standard: ISO 9001-Certified Precision CNC Machining & Stamping
- Key Processes: CNC milling (perforated plates/bars/brackets), precision stamping (circular rings), hole tapping/drilling (standardized mounting features).
- Dimensional Tolerance: ±0.02mm (ensures alignment of modular parts).
- Hole Specifications: Standard M3/M4 threaded/unthreaded holes (uniform spacing for universal compatibility).
- Surface Finish: Natural anodized (50–80μm thickness; enhances wear resistance).
